Attending live events like concerts, sports games, and tours has become a luxury experience due to the rising ticket prices. The average cost of a concert ticket has increased to around $133, making it more expensive to see popular artists and sports teams. Factors like Live Nation's dominance in ticketing, service fees, dynamic pricing, and the secondary resale market contribute to the high costs, making it challenging for some fans to afford attending live events.

The exorbitant prices of tickets raise questions about who can afford to attend these events and what motivates them to spend so much money. One individual, Craig, a 44-year-old from the Bay Area earning $180,000 annually, shared his experience of spending over $15,000 to see Beyoncé's Cowboy Carter Tour six times. Craig's passion for Beyoncé and his willingness to invest in creating memories through live experiences drove him to attend multiple shows, despite the financial implications.

Craig's decision to attend multiple shows stemmed from his deep admiration for Beyoncé and the unique communal experience that live events offer. His dedication to seeing Beyoncé perform live led him to purchase expensive tickets close to the stage, creating unforgettable memories and connections with fellow fans. Despite the financial strain and lack of prior planning, Craig has no regrets about his decision to attend multiple shows and views it as a valuable investment in his happiness.
